CHILDREN at a popular Crewe nursery were given the red carpet treatment at a special graduation ceremony.

Youngsters at Starting Point Child Care Centre, based at South Cheshire College, were given a fantastic send off by staff and other toddlers at the nursery.

More than 20 children, aged three and four years old, are now heading to primary school and many have attended the nursery since they were just a few months old.

They said their fond farewells at the presentation which took place in the forest which adjoins the nursery and outdoor play area.

Julie Jervis, Starting Point Child Care centre manager, said: “The graduation ceremony was a way of giving children the perfect send-off as they head to primary school in September.

“It’s sad to see them go as many of them have been with us since they were very young, but we wish them all the best for the future at school and beyond.”
